CHESTNUT AND RED WINE PâTé

Ingredients
  • 1 tbsp olive or groundnut oil
  • 1 small onion
  • finely chopped
  • 1 clove of garlic
  • crushed
  • pinch dried thyme
  • 150ml/¼pt red wine
  • 150ml/¼pt vegetable stock
  • 100g/4oz chopped chestnuts (cooked weight)
  • 100g/4oz chestnut purée
  • 75g/3oz wholemeal breadcrumbs
  • 1 tbsp brandy
  • 10-15ml/2-3 tsp soy sauce
  • salt and freshly ground black pepper
  • fresh herbs
  • crackers and a fresh green salad
Directions
  • Heat the oil in a saucepan
  • gently cook the onion and garlic with the dried thyme until soft.
  • Add the red wine and vegetable stock and bring to the boil.
  • Remove from the heat and stir in the chopped chestnuts
  • chestnut purée
  • breadcrumbs
  • brandy and soy sauce.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Cook over a gentle heat until thickened. Spoon the pate into individual ramekins
  • smooth the surface and then chill in the refrigerator until required.
  • Serve garnished with fresh herbs
  • with crackers and crisp green salad leaves.
